Android基础应用程序框架

来源:互联网 发布:量子网络石家庄 编辑:程序博客网 时间:2024/05/16 08:09

下面的应用程序服务是所有的Android应用程序架构的基础,常用软件都会使用到的框架:

Activity Manager 和Fragment Manager  分别控制了Activity和Fragement的生命周期,对Activity栈进行管理。

视图(VIEW)用来给Activity和Fragement构建用户界面。

Notification manager(通知管理器),提供了一种一致的和非打断性的机制来通知用户。

Content Provider(内容提供器),让应用程序可以共享数据。

Resource Manager(资源管理器),支持字符串和图形这样的非代码资源的具体化。

Intent 提供了一种在应用程序及组件之间传递数据的机制。

Android提供了大量额API供开发使用,要想了解Android SDK中的包的完整列表,可以参考:http://developer.android.com/reference/packages.html上提供的文档

Android是针对大量的移动硬件设计的,所以要注意,一些高级或可选的API的适用性可能因Android设备而异。

0 0
原创粉丝点击